The first Conference Finals matchup is set, and it happens to be in the Eastern Conference. The New York Knicks will battle the Indiana Pacers. The winner will advance to the NBA Finals. The Pacers took out the Cleveland Cavaliers in five games. The Cavs were the favorites seeing they had their best record in the Eastern Conference this season. The Cavs were my pick to advance to the Eastern Conference Finals, but it was wrong. New York took out the defending NBA champion Celtics in six games. Jayson Tatum ruptured his Achilles towards the end of Game 4, but the Knicks were the hungrier team before the injury. The Knicks and Pacers met in the semifinal round a season ago and the Pacers advanced. New York dealt with injuries in the playoffs a season ago, but both teams are healthy. Indiana Pacers

The Indiana Pacers haven’t reached the NBA Finals since the year 2000. Indiana is one step closer to playing for an NBA Championship. The Pacers have never won an NBA Championship in franchise history. They won all three of their titles while they were a part of the ABA. Tyrese Haliburton is the star of the team, but the Pacers have a complete squad. Myles Turner has been amazing during this playoff run. Pascal Siakim brings his championship experience from Toronto. Aaron Nesmith and Andrew Nembhard have been aggressive and got buckets when the team needed them. Can they continue their impressive run against the Knicks?
